Mixly是一款基于Scratch的图形化编程软件,它旨在为编程初学者提供一个简单易用的编程环境。Mixly不仅继承了Scratch的易用性,还增加了许多自定义功能,使得编程学习变得更加有趣和高效。本文将详细介绍Mixly的特点,以及如何轻松调用自定义功能,带领读者进入编程学习的新境界。
Mixly简介
Mixly是一款开源的图形化编程软件,它基于Scratch 2.0开发,同时兼容Scratch 3.0。Mixly的设计理念是将编程语言简化为图形化的模块,用户可以通过拖拽模块来编写程序,从而降低了编程学习的门槛。
Mixly的特点
- 简单易用:Mixly的界面设计简洁直观,用户可以轻松上手。
- 功能丰富:Mixly内置了大量的模块,涵盖了运动、外观、声音、控制、数据等各个方面。
- 自定义功能:Mixly支持用户自定义模块,可以扩展软件的功能。
- 跨平台:Mixly支持Windows、MacOS和Linux操作系统。
如何调用自定义功能
1. 创建自定义模块
首先,需要创建一个自定义模块。以下是一个简单的例子,演示如何创建一个名为“Hello World”的自定义模块。
// 定义模块
function Hello_World() {
// 输出“Hello World”
console.log("Hello World");
}
// 导出模块
export { Hello_World };
2. 在Mixly中使用自定义模块
在Mixly中,将自定义模块拖拽到程序编辑区,即可使用它。
3. 调用自定义模块
在程序中,可以通过以下方式调用自定义模块:
// 调用自定义模块
Hello_World();
4. 修改自定义模块
如果需要修改自定义模块,只需打开模块的代码文件,进行相应的修改即可。
Mixly的应用场景
- 教育领域:Mixly可以用于教学编程基础,帮助学生快速掌握编程思维。
- 创客活动:Mixly可以帮助创客实现各种创意项目,如智能机器人、智能家居等。
- 企业培训:Mixly可以用于企业员工的编程技能培训,提高员工的创新能力。
总结
Mixly是一款功能强大的图形化编程软件,它通过自定义功能,为编程学习带来了新的可能性。通过本文的介绍,相信读者已经对Mixly有了更深入的了解。希望读者能够利用Mixly,轻松调用自定义功能,开启编程学习的新境界。
